What are congruent triangles?

Back

Triangles that have the same size and shape, meaning their corresponding sides and angles are equal.

What does SSS stand for in triangle congruence?

Back

Side-Side-Side; a method to prove triangles are congruent if all three sides of one triangle are equal to the three sides of another triangle.

What does SAS stand for in triangle congruence?

Back

Side-Angle-Side; a method to prove triangles are congruent if two sides and the included angle of one triangle are equal to two sides and the included angle of another triangle.

What does ASA stand for in triangle congruence?

Back

Angle-Side-Angle; a method to prove triangles are congruent if two angles and the included side of one triangle are equal to two angles and the included side of another triangle.

What does AAS stand for in triangle congruence?

Back

Angle-Angle-Side; a method to prove triangles are congruent if two angles and a non-included side of one triangle are equal to two angles and the corresponding non-included side of another triangle.

What is the definition of an isosceles triangle?

Back

A triangle that has at least two sides of equal length.

What is the definition of a scalene triangle?

Back

A triangle in which all three sides are of different lengths.
